Audit Preparation and Compliance for Financial Executives Course Curriculum
Course Overview This comprehensive course is designed for financial executives to gain in-depth knowledge and skills in audit preparation and compliance. The course is interactive, engaging, and practical, with real-world applications and expert instructors.
Course Objectives - Understand the audit process and its importance in financial management
- Identify and assess risks associated with financial reporting
- Develop strategies for effective audit preparation and compliance
- Implement internal controls and risk management frameworks
- Analyze financial statements and identify areas for improvement
Course Outline Module 1: Introduction to Audit Preparation and Compliance
- Overview of the audit process
- Importance of audit preparation and compliance
- Regulatory requirements and standards
- Role of financial executives in audit preparation
Module 2: Risk Assessment and Management
- Identifying and assessing risks associated with financial reporting
- Risk management frameworks and internal controls
- Implementing risk management strategies
- Monitoring and reviewing risk management processes
Module 3: Internal Controls and Compliance
- Understanding internal controls and their importance
- Designing and implementing effective internal controls
- Compliance with regulatory requirements and standards
- Testing and evaluating internal controls
Module 4: Financial Statement Analysis and Audit Preparation
- Analyzing financial statements and identifying areas for improvement
- Preparing financial statements for audit
- Understanding audit procedures and protocols
- Responding to audit findings and recommendations
Module 5: Audit Committee and Board Responsibilities
- Role of the audit committee and board in audit preparation
- Oversight of the audit process
- Reviewing and approving audit plans and reports
- Ensuring audit committee and board effectiveness
Module 6: Audit Reporting and Communication
- Understanding audit reports and their implications
- Communicating audit findings and recommendations
- Responding to audit reports and implementing recommendations
- Best practices for audit reporting and communication
Module 7: Advanced Topics in Audit Preparation and Compliance
- Emerging trends and issues in audit preparation and compliance
- Advanced risk management strategies
- Using technology to enhance audit preparation and compliance
- Best practices for maintaining audit readiness
